logo

Output 586563522cc7bc7d1798803a08242ec5804c264e38f2ca393dbffe4b76198650:1

value
1339581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a36d4b11e85aa2a2ac8ce1bb90bb26778a59de69 OP_EQUALVERIFY OP_CHECKSIG
address
1Fu856ZkHQCv5HS9Wu6AZkhcAE9jBpiEHW
transaction
586563522cc7bc7d1798803a08242ec5804c264e38f2ca393dbffe4b76198650